Rights of a tanent in pagdi system

(Querist) 03 May 2013 This query is : Resolved 
sir,

my mother is 70 years old lady . we are living in a pagdi system room since 1968 in mumbai suberbs. we were paying rent till 2006 than owner stop accepting rent .now the building is in ill condition and bmc sent us notice to vacant the place asap.we are not finacially strong . only 4 tanents are living in the building right now and 12 other tanents are still occuping rooms . kindly guide us because owner is creating problems for us by disconnecting electricity and water supply .we are regularly paying electricity and water bills . he is not ready to give alternate accomodation .
ajay sethi (Expert) 03 May 2013
send rent arrears along with covering letter to landlord by speed post AD .

complain to local police station regarding disconnection of electricity and water supply .

file declaratory suit and deposit rent in court if landlord refuses to accept it
